Respiratory Depth
Respiratory depth measures the volume of air inhaled or exhaled during a breath. It can vary from shallow to deep and typically remains consistent when a person is at rest or asleep. Occasionally, individuals will automatically inhale deeply, known as sighing, which inflates the lungs with more air than normal breathing.

Respiratory capacities are crucial indicators of lung function, representing the maximum amount of air an individual's respiratory system can handle during various breathing phases.
One key metric is the Inspiratory Capacity (IC), which represents the maximum amount of air that can be inhaled with full effort. IC is calculated by summing the tidal volume and inspiratory reserve volume, typically ranging from 2.4 to 3.6 liters.

科学领域:

  • 心肺生理学 心肺生理学
  • 呼吸系统医学 呼吸系统医学
  • 运动科学 运动科学

背景情况:

  • 心肺运动测试 (CPET) 对于评估炼性呼吸困难至关重要.
  • 缺乏规范性数据阻碍了CPET期间呼吸困难反应的解释.
  • 制定参考方程对于准确的临床评估至关重要.

研究的目的:

  • 创建CPET期间喘息强度的规范性参考方程.
  • 为40岁及以上的男性和女性建立方程.
  • 为了将呼吸困难与输出功率,氧气吸收和每分钟通风相关联.

主要方法:

  • 从CanCOLD研究中对接受增量周期CPET的健康成年人 (年龄>=40) 进行分析.
  • 编制顺序多项逻辑回归模型,用于呼吸困难的评分.
  • 用加拿大健康成年人的独立样本对模型进行外部验证.

主要成果:

  • 制定了针对男性和女性的单独规范参考方程,考虑到年龄和体重.
  • 模型表现出高性能,C统计在验证中从0.81到0.96不等.
  • 包括156名参与者 (43%为女性),平均年龄为65岁.

结论:

  • 在CPET过程中提供了炼性喘息强度的规范性参考方程.
  • 能够比较个人和群体之间的呼吸困难评级.
  • 有助于识别和量化异常喘息反应.
